Analysis
In 2025, dec alternative conversion factor in Ethiopia stood at 119.46 LCU per US$. That is the highest value across all 66 years on record.
The figure is up 51.8% on the previous year and up 471.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, dec alternative conversion factor in Ethiopia peaked at 119.46 LCU per US$ in 2025 and was at its lowest, 2.07 LCU per US$, in 1974.
That places Ethiopia 64th out of 214 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 2.49 LCU per US$ | 2.48 LCU per US$ | 2.5 LCU per US$ | 10 |
| 1970s | 2.18 LCU per US$ | 2.07 LCU per US$ | 2.5 LCU per US$ | 10 |
| 1980s | 2.07 LCU per US$ | 2.07 LCU per US$ | 2.07 LCU per US$ | 10 |
| 1990s | 5.05 LCU per US$ | 2.07 LCU per US$ | 7.51 LCU per US$ | 10 |
| 2000s | 8.8 LCU per US$ | 8.15 LCU per US$ | 10.42 LCU per US$ | 10 |
| 2010s | 20.7 LCU per US$ | 12.89 LCU per US$ | 29.3 LCU per US$ | 10 |
| 2020s | 64.39 LCU per US$ | 34.2 LCU per US$ | 119.46 LCU per US$ | 6 |

About this data
The DEC alternative conversion factor is the underlying annual exchange rate (the price of one country’s currency in relation to another country's currency) used for the World Bank Atlas method. As a rule, it is the official exchange rate reported in the IMF's International Financial Statistics. Exceptions arise where further refinements are made by World Bank staff. It is expressed in local currency units per U.S. dollar.
